Priest Anatol Cibric, who is the bishop of Saint Parascheva Church, said the homosexuality imposed by the West, the plays similar to The Monologues of the Vagina, the abortions and the revels in the Great National Assembly Square, including on the Independence Day, are among the most serious problems faced by the society. The priest said the society can reach God only if the people detach themselves from all the sins.
The new technologies and blasphemy invaded the society, endanger the good faith and make the people tolerate the sins. The people forgot what confession and love for the fellows are. Related statement were made during the third theological conference themed “Confession of Faith: between Love and Tolerance” on Monday, February 8. Several hundreds of clerics and invitees attended the conference, Info-Prim Neo reports.
“The new technologies invaded the society and revealed all the sins, while the people, in order to be modern and keep abreast of all the latest developments, tolerate them and such blasphemous behaviors as homosexuality, prostitution, drug addictiveness, abortion and euthanasia that hide under the umbrella of tolerance,” said His Holiness Vladimir, the Metropolitan Bishop of Chisinau and All Moldova.
The Bishop called on the society to avoid committing sins. “We are urged to avoid the temptations and to take care of the soul. The TV set and the computer bombard the society, but the people tolerate and forget what good faith is,” he said.
Viorel Rusu, bishop of the Church in Floreni village of Anenii Noi district, said the people should go to confession. “We must confess our sins and pray for God's forgiveness. The society today is divided, but the confession and love can unite us.”
The first theological conference took place in 2005, while the second in 2007.
